Course Content

• The Geopolitics of the Persian Gulf: An Introduction
• Energy Security and the Persian Gulf: Oil, Gas, and Geopolitical Power
• Regional Rivalries and Alliances in the Persian Gulf: Iran, Saudi Arabia, and the UAE
• The Impact of External Powers on the Persian Gulf: US, China, and Russia
• Maritime Security and the Strait of Hormuz: Challenges and Implications
• Socio-Political Dynamics within Gulf States: Governance and Social Change
• Terrorism and Insurgency in the Persian Gulf Region
• Economic Diversification and Development Strategies in the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C)
• Water Security in the Arabian Peninsula: Scarcity and Conflict
• The Future of Persian Gulf Geopolitics: Emerging Trends and Scenarios
